Public Health in Crises and Transitional Contexts
Next course: 2010 dates to be confirmed - please email us at training@merlin.org.uk if you would like to receive notification once these dates have been set.
This is a seven day non-residential course which has been designed to meet the learning needs of health and other professionals involved or interested in working in the humanitarian assistance sector. It will cover the common problems encountered, how to understand them and practical interventions.

Analysing disrupted health systems course (IRC, Merlin & WHO)
Next course: 14 - 26 March 2010
Please note: This course will be in French and is aimed at people working in francophone countries.
Location: Hammamet, Tunisia
This 13-day residential training course is run in partnership with WHO and IRC and is funded by USAID/OFDA. The course focuses on the analysis of the health systems of countries affected by, or recovering from, protracted crises.
The course is intended for health professionals working in or on countries in crisis: WHO staff, health personnel in government institutions, NGOs, UN agencies and other humanitarian organisations.
